Household name: Peace lily

Scientific name: Spathiphyllum

Size: Ranges from 2 to 4 feet.

How it makes your home better: Improves air quality by absorbing harmful chemicals found in common household products such as paint, nail polish, solvents, adhesive, ink and varnishes.

Watch out for: Insects and wilting. Occasionally dab leaves with water to avoid insect infestation and be sure to properly drain excess water to prevent their roots from rotting.
